Why Consider Skip Hire?
1. Convenience at Its Best
Skip hire offers unparalleled convenience when managing waste. Instead of multiple trips to the landfill, you can have a container delivered to your location. Once filled, the company collects and disposes of the waste responsibly. This saves time and effort, especially for large-scale projects.
2. Environmental Benefits
Using skip hire contributes to sustainable waste management. Most providers prioritise recycling, ensuring that waste is segregated and reused wherever possible. For instance, according to industry reports, 70% of waste collected via skips is recycled, reducing the strain on landfills.
3. Cost Efficiency
Contrary to popular belief, hiring a skip can be more affordable than arranging separate waste removal services. Many companies offer flexible pricing based on skip size, rental period, and location, making it suitable for both small domestic projects and large commercial ventures.
Types of Projects Suitable for Skip Hire
Residential Use
Home Renovations: Projects like kitchen or bathroom renovations generate a lot of debris, including plaster, tiles, and fixtures.
Garden Clearance: Clearing out old shrubs, soil, or landscaping waste is easier with a skip on-site.
Spring Cleaning: Decluttering your home? A skip can handle bulk disposal of old furniture, appliances, and miscellaneous junk.
Business Use
Construction Sites: Construction waste like bricks, concrete, and metal can quickly accumulate. Skips provide an efficient disposal method.
Office Clearouts: Businesses undergoing relocations or refurbishments often generate electronic waste and old office furniture.
Retail Waste Management: Retailers managing seasonal inventory changes or store remodels benefit from easy and quick disposal solutions.
How to Choose the Right Skip Size?
Mini Skips
Ideal for small projects such as garden waste or minor decluttering. These typically hold around 25–35 bin bags.
Midi Skips
Perfect for medium-scale projects like home renovations, with a capacity of up to 70 bin bags.
Large Skips
Best suited for construction or commercial projects, offering space for approximately 100–120 bin bags.
Roll-on Roll-off Skips
These are used for industrial-level waste disposal, accommodating large volumes efficiently.

Challenges and Considerations of Skip Hire
1. Space Limitations
For residential areas, limited driveway or street space can be a concern. Check local permissions before placing a skip on public property.
2. Restricted Waste Types
Not all waste can be disposed of in a skip. Hazardous materials like asbestos, chemicals, or batteries require special handling.
3. Costs for Extended Rentals
While skip hire is cost-effective for short durations, extended rentals may incur additional charges. Plan your usage timeline to avoid extra costs.
How to Make the Most of Skip Hire
Plan Ahead
Estimate the volume and type of waste you’ll generate to choose the appropriate skip size. Overfilling skips can result in fines or additional fees.
Know the Rules
Research local regulations for skip placement and waste disposal to avoid penalties. For example, Slough has specific guidelines for skips placed on public roads.
Compare Services
Not all skip hire companies are the same. Compare providers for pricing, waste recycling rates, and customer reviews to ensure you’re getting the best deal.
Alternatives to Skip Hire
While skip hire is highly effective, other waste management options may suit smaller projects or unique needs:
Man-and-Van Services: Suitable for small-scale waste removal without the need for permits.
Local Recycling Centres: Ideal for minimal waste quantities.
Grab Lorries: Efficient for larger volumes of soil or rubble from construction sites.
